I have a 4-D Maglite that uses a Terralux 310 LED inside it. It is 1000 lumens and runs down normal D size batteries in about 2 hours. I was wondering if you guys know of any rechargeable D size batteries that are strong enough to run this LED upgrade?

The Terralux 310 requires at least 6 volts of power in order to be used. Regular D size batteries have 1.5 volts of power each which is enough to produce 6 volts inside a 4-D Maglite.

The problem that I am having is that all of the rechargeable D size batteries that I have seen only can produce up to 1.2 volts of power. That is only a total of 4.8 volts inside a 4-D Maglite which won't be enough to power the Terralux 310. Even the highest quality rechargeable D size batteries like "Powerex" can only produce up to 1.2 volts of power each.

How can I get at least 6 volts of power from rechargeable batteries inside a 4-D Maglite and make them fit?

Mentioned drop in is designed to work with four 1.2 volt batteries because alkalines drop to about 1.2 volt under load.

However, you can use 5 "C" cells inside 4D barrel using PVC tube and modify tail spring for good contact. You will get higher voltage with less run time.

My suggestion is to use pair of protected 18650 with PVC tube in 2D M*g. Maximum safe voltage, shorter and light weight body, less self discharge and good run time.
